Ferramentas de Linha de Comando · 7 min read · Dec 31, 2025
Windows PowerShell vs Windows Terminal vs Command Prompt: Qual é a Diferença

Prompt de Comando ou popularmente conhecido como CMD, é um daqueles aplicativos que está com o Windows desde seu início. Mas agora, junto com o CMD, o Windows oferece mais duas ferramentas de linha de comando, PowerShell que foi introduzido no Windows XP, e o novo Windows Terminal, que fez sua estreia no Windows 10 e agora também está disponível no Windows 11. Então, por que o Windows introduz as outras duas ferramentas, quando o CMD estava atendendo a todas as necessidades? E qual é a diferença significativa entre CMD, PowerShell e Windows Terminal? Vamos descobrir a resposta neste post.
Comparação Tabular Entre Prompt de Comando, PowerShell e Terminal
Hoje em dia, a maioria de nós quer uma comparação rápida e direta entre os serviços. Ninguém gosta de passar por longos parágrafos entediantes. E se você também faz parte desse grupo, aqui está uma comparação tabular entre Prompt de Comando, Windows PowerShell e Windows Terminal. Mas caso você tenha alguma dúvida sobre qualquer um dos pontos mencionados abaixo, recomendamos que você passe por comparações detalhadas que seguem os dados tabulares.
| Prompt de Comando | Windows PowerShell | Windows Terminal | |
| Interface | Fundo preto simples onde você pode digitar códigos com fontes brancas. | Fundo azul e fontes de escrita amarelas e vermelhas. | Oferece uma ampla variedade de espectros e esquemas de cores. Você pode até criar seu próprio esquema de cores personalizado. |
| Uso | Usado para corrigir facilmente a maioria dos erros do Windows e até excluir arquivos corrompidos. | PowerShell dá acesso de administrador para controlar diferentes sistemas conectados a uma rede em uma organização. Pode executar facilmente comandos Batch e Shell. | Terminal é compatível com caracteres Unicode, UTF-8 e textos acelerados por GPU |
O que é o Prompt de Comando ou CMD?
Prompt de Comando ou CMD era inicialmente conhecido como Command.com, e foi introduzido com o Windows 95 e 98. Mas a maioria de nós, que está com o Windows desde seu início, conhece essa ferramenta de linha de comando como MS-DOS, e há uma forte razão para isso também. Inicialmente, era usado principalmente para executar comandos DOS como comandos DIR. Também era usado para executar testes de velocidade da internet.
A Microsoft posteriormente introduziu o Prompt de Comando no Windows New Technology (NT). Agora, o CMD é usado para realizar várias funções administrativas avançadas. Também é usado para solucionar ou resolver diferentes tipos de problemas do Windows executando scripts e arquivos em lote.
O que é o Windows PowerShell?
Como mencionado, o Windows PowerShell foi introduzido em 2006 com o Windows XP. E a melhor parte é que qualquer coisa que você possa executar no Prompt de Comando funcionará no Windows PowerShell também. No entanto, o PowerShell é um shell de comando e uma linguagem de script introduzida para realizar diferentes tarefas administrativas do sistema.
O Windows PowerShell é usado para controlar o que está acontecendo dentro do SO. Além disso, também dá acesso ao gerenciador de registro, sistema de arquivos e cria scripts complexos com vários cenários.
O que é o Windows Terminal?
O Windows Terminal é a mais nova adição à lista de ferramentas de linha de comando. Ao contrário das outras, é um aplicativo de código aberto que está disponível no GitHub. No Windows Terminal, você pode executar comandos do Prompt de Comando, Windows PowerShell, Linux, bem como WSL. A capacidade de executar comandos Linux permite BASH, que é limitado apenas ao sistema operacional Linux.
O Windows Terminal vem pré-instalado no Windows 10, bem como na mais recente versão do Windows 11. Você pode até baixá-lo na loja da Microsoft.
Prompt de Comando vs Windows PowerShell vs Windows Terminal
Agora que você conhece os significados básicos dessas ferramentas de linha de comando, vamos verificar a diferença significativa entre elas. Embora todas sejam linguagens de script introduzidas para resolver problemas padrão do Windows, executar comandos em lote e manter o SO, ainda existem várias diferenças que tornam cada uma diferente das outras.
Prompt de Comando vs. Windows PowerShell vs. Windows Terminal: Interface

O Prompt de Comando tem uma das interfaces mais simples entre todas as ferramentas de linha de comando. É uma réplica completa de como os gráficos de computador costumavam parecer no início dos anos 2000. Para ser preciso, o prompt de comando tem um fundo preto simples, onde você pode digitar códigos com fontes brancas.

O Windows PowerShell tem uma interface comparativamente intuitiva. Ao contrário do Prompt de Comando, ele não se baseia apenas nas cores preta e branca. Na verdade, ele levou as coisas um passo adiante, oferecendo fundo azul e fontes de escrita amarelas e vermelhas. Mas você pode ter o preto e branco também, passando pelas configurações.

O mais recente, Windows Terminal, tem a interface mais avançada entre todas as ferramentas de linha de comando. Ele adotou uma abordagem de navegador, ou seja, dá acesso para abrir várias abas e trabalhar em cada uma delas simultaneamente. Na verdade, gerenciar várias abas no Windows Terminal é realmente divertido e fácil.

Além disso, ao contrário de outras ferramentas, não é limitado a um certo número de esquemas de cores. Na verdade, oferece uma ampla variedade de espectros e esquemas de cores, e você pode até criar seu próprio esquema de cores personalizado. Além disso, há um menu de configurações dedicado onde você pode ajustar diferentes cores e ter uma aparência de acordo com seu desejo.
O Windows Terminal também dá acesso para criar vários perfis. E o mais importante, diferentes perfis podem ter configurações diferentes. Assim, todos que usam o Windows Terminal em um PC com Windows 10 ou 11 podem ter seus próprios Shells, Terminais e túneis SSH.
O Windows PowerShell oferece um fundo azul completo que você pode mudar conforme seu desejo para encerrar a batalha de interface. Mas o Windows Terminal está em um nível completamente diferente em comparação ao PowerShell e ao clássico cult Prompt de Comando. Isso claramente não significa que o PowerShell está no lado mais fraco. É poderoso e capaz. Mas quando se trata de UI, o Windows Terminal é o vencedor claro.
Prompt de Comando vs. Windows PowerShell vs. Windows Terminal: Uso
O Prompt de Comando é preferido principalmente por usuários que gostariam de realizar tarefas administrativas como formatação e gerenciamento de partições de disco. Também era usado para monitorar dados armazenados no usuário, bem como no sistema. O CMD permite que você acesse arquivos do sistema; portanto, você pode corrigir facilmente a maioria dos erros do Windows e até excluir arquivos corrompidos.
O Windows PowerShell pode realizar todos os serviços que o CMD oferece. Além disso, o PowerShell dá acesso de administrador para controlar diferentes sistemas conectados a uma rede em uma organização. Ao contrário do CMD, o PowerShell não é apenas compatível com comandos em lote, onde você deve inserir um certo número de comandos, e ele executará cada um deles um por um sem receber mais entradas de sua parte. Na verdade, ele pode executar facilmente comandos em lote e Shell.
O Windows PowerShell usa cmdlets, que significam grupos de instruções. É mais como uma “função” se você vem de um fundo de programação. Assim, semelhante a funções, você pode usar cmdlets para executar várias operações com um único comando.
O Windows Terminal é a ferramenta de linha de comando mais avançada. Ele usa BASH em todo seu potencial, que era inicialmente limitado apenas ao sistema operacional Linux. Ao contrário do CMD e do PowerShell, o Terminal também é compatível com caracteres Unicode, UTF-8 e textos acelerados por GPU. A disponibilidade de um mecanismo de renderização de texto acelerado por GPU torna possível que o terminal trabalhe com emojis, caracteres especiais, ícones e diferentes tipos de fontes.
Como mencionado, o Windows Terminal é um projeto de código aberto. Portanto, não seria uma surpresa se mais novos e avançados recursos forem introduzidos a esta ferramenta de linha de comando no futuro. A Microsoft disse que tornará o Windows compatível com BASH, tornando possível que os usuários executem o Ubuntu no Windows. Embora essa promessa nunca tenha se tornado realidade, agora é possível com a ajuda do Windows Terminal.
Prompt de Comando vs Windows PowerShell vs Windows Terminal: Qual Você Deve Usar?
O Windows Terminal tomou completamente o charme do Windows PowerShell, da mesma forma que o PowerShell tomou o CMD. O Windows Terminal é um pacote completo das ferramentas de linha de comando. E é retrocompatível, ou seja, você pode fazer tudo nele que pode fazer no CMD e no PowerShell.
Em termos leigos, o Windows Terminal será uma opção ideal para você, pois pode executar todos os comandos e oferece uma interface intuitiva.
Então, isso é tudo para este post. Na seção de comentários, deixe-nos saber seus pensamentos sobre a comparação entre Prompt de Comando vs Windows PowerShell vs Windows Terminal.
Se você tiver alguma opinião sobre Windows PowerShell vs Windows Terminal vs Command Prompt: Qual é a Diferença, sinta-se à vontade para deixar um comentário abaixo. Além disso, inscreva-se no nosso canal do YouTube DigitBin para tutoriais em vídeo. Saúde!
Receba novas postagens na sua caixa de entrada
Sem spam. Cancele a assinatura a qualquer momento.